CME dairy markets down Monday

Milk futures and most cash dairy markets were down on the Chicago Mercantile Exchange Monday, August 2nd.

August Class III milk was down $.18 at $16.11.  September was down $.21 closing at $16.15.  October was down $.27 at $16.67.  November was down $.18 at $17.38.  December through June contracts ranged from fifteen cents lower to six cents higher.

Dry whey was unchanged at $.5025. There were no trades recorded.

Blocks were unchanged at $1.6350.  No sales were recorded.  

Barrels went down $.08 to $1.31.  There were nine sales from $1.31 to $1.3625.

Butter closed up $.0575 at $1.70.  There were fourteen sales ranging from $1.6625 to $1.70. 

Nonfat dry milk was up $.0075 to $1.2750.  One sale was made at the price.
